GoCD 환경 구성
GoCD는 Jenkins Master/Agent와 비슷하게 GoCD Server와 1개 이상의 GoCD Agent로 구성됩니다.
GoCD를 설치하고 서버의 8153번 포트로 들어가면 젠킨스 같은 관리 페이지가 나오고 여기서 파이프라인을 만들 수 있습니다.
GoCD 설치
sudo curl https://download.gocd.org/gocd.repo -o /etc/yum.repos.d/gocd.repo
# JDK 1.8 or 11설치 필요
# GoCD Server 설치
sudo yum install -y go-server
# goCD server start
sudo /etc/init.d/go-server start
sudo service go-server start
GoCD console
GoCD를 설치하고 8153번 포트로 들어가면 다음과 같은 화면으로 접속할 수 있습니다.
사용자를 등록하기 위해
Authentication
GoCD console에 인증해서 접속하기 위해 사용자를 생성하기 다음과 같이 수행합니다.
sudo yum -y install httpd-tools
sudo mkdir -p /opt/godata/password
sudo su - go
cd /etc/go
htpasswd -c -s password admin
GoCD Admin > Security > Authorization Configuration 을 선택합니다.
사용자를 등록합니다.
댓글남기기